Five Criteria to Judge Any Modern Poker Table Format

Platforms that look alike on the surface can feel completely different in daily use. These five criteria separate a working poker offer from a decorative one.

Transparency: Checking Who Runs the Game

Transparency starts with basic questions. Who operates the poker section? Which regulatory body holds the licence, and are the rules of each table variant explained without a support ticket? A transparent platform publishes its rake structure and payout information as well.

If those details are absent, treat the silence as a warning, not a minor inconvenience.

Speed: Relying on the Least Exciting House Edge

Poker is played among players, but the platform still takes a share. Speed therefore has two parts. Technical speed means cards load quickly and the client does not disconnect during a big decision. Transactional speed means deposits and withdrawals follow the promised timeline.

Technical speed can be tested in a free or low-stakes game. Transactional speed is easier to research: a long list of delayed withdrawal complaints is evidence, and the absence of such reports is a positive signal, though not a promise.

Usability: Finding the Right Table Without Friction

Usability decides whether players return after the first session. A good lobby offers filters by game type, stake level, table size, and player count, and labels tournament registration windows clearly.

A useful test: can a player find the poker section, see the available formats, and filter by stakes within sixty seconds? If not, the collection may be rich but impractical.

Security: Account Protection and Fair Play

Security covers more than encryption. The platform holds money, personal data, and hand histories. The player should ask how all three are protected. Two-factor authentication, withdrawal verification steps, and a clear data policy belong on the checklist.

Fair play is missing from many conversations. Players should look for an independent audit of the poker software. When an operator does not mention one, the fairness question remains open.

Support: What Happens When You Need Help

No one needs support during a great session. They need it when a withdrawal stalls or a login fails an hour before tournament time. A useful team answers clearly and does not hide behind FAQ links.

Test support before you need it. A simple question about buy-in limits or withdrawal times will show how the team actually responds. Community reports about an online poker room like QH88 can help, but your own test is the most reliable source.

Criterion What to look for Red flags
Transparency Clear operator details, readable game rules, published payout information Missing licence, hidden fees, vague claims about game fairness
Speed Fast lobby load, stable client, reasonable withdrawal processing Frequent disconnects, long verification requests without explanation
Usability Sensible table filters, clear buy-in labels, obvious tournament lobby Confusing navigation, misleading information about player counts
Security Two-factor authentication, certified software, responsible gaming tools No account protections, unclear data handling, no self-exclusion options
Support First response quality, clear answers, availability when needed Automated replies, long waits, support that cannot identify basic platform rules

A Practical Checklist Before You Even Join a Table

Every review has the same limit: a screenshot cannot show server lag. The player can follow a short checklist before depositing.

  1. Open the lobby and list the table formats that actually have active or joinable tables.
  2. Check the stakes. The buy-in should fit your bankroll, not the other way around.
  3. Send support a simple question about which variants are active and the minimum buy-ins. Note the time and the quality of the answer.
  4. Read the terms tied to poker: withdrawal limits, verification steps, and inactivity fees.
  5. Set a bankroll limit before you open a table and use any responsible gaming tools the platform offers.

These steps do not guarantee a good session, but they prevent the most common disappointments.

The Less Visible Risks of Modern Poker Platforms

Even when a platform checks every box, poker has structural risks that little marketing copy mentions. The first is the rake. A player can win more hands than they lose and still finish the night below zero, because the platform takes a share from every pot. Players should compare rake across stakes; the difference directly affects profitability.

The second risk is the player pool. Fast-fold and short-deck formats work only when enough people are seated. A table that looks alive at 8 PM can be empty on a Tuesday morning. That is an operational reality, not necessarily a flaw in the site.

The third risk sits in the bonus system. Some platforms offer sign-up bonuses that must be churned through casino games, while poker activity counts very little. Anyone who intends to play mainly poker should read the bonus terms and confirm that poker contributes to wagering.

Finally, there is the risk that no platform can eliminate: the player's own decisions. Short-deck games and fast blind structures can increase losses faster than expected. The only workable protection is a loss limit set before the first hand.

Frequently Asked Questions About the Poker Collection

Are modern table formats a good entry point for beginners?
Some are. Slow tournaments and fixed-limit tables give beginners time to think. Fast-fold and short-deck games compress decision time and change hand rankings, so they are less forgiving.

Can I verify fairness?
Look for third-party certification, software provider details, and clear rules. If no independent audit is named, treat the fairness claim as unverified.

What should I do about a delayed withdrawal?
Compare the delay with the platform's own terms, contact support, and keep records. If the problem continues, look for licence details and consider filing a complaint with the issuing authority.
